Starscream’s fanfictions excel at dissecting his ego and paranoia. Writers love to put him in scenarios where his schemes backfire, forcing him to confront his own weaknesses. A recurring theme is his obsession with power being a cover for deep-seated inadequacy. Fics like 'The Fallen’s Shadow' show him wrestling with memories of Cybertron’s glory days, contrasting his past aspirations with his current failures. His dynamics with other Decepticons—especially Megatron—are often portrayed as a volatile mix of hatred and twisted respect. Some stories focus on rare moments of vulnerability, like his brief alliance with Autobots in 'Transformers: Animated', revealing layers beneath his usual bravado. The best works balance his ruthlessness with glimpses of the mech he could’ve been, making his downfall all the more compelling.

Starscream fanfictions dive deep into his chaotic psyche, often painting him as a tragic figure trapped between ambition and insecurity. His emotional conflicts stem from a desperate need for validation, which Megatron consistently denies, fueling his endless power struggles. Many fics highlight his internal battle—wanting to overthrow Megatron but fearing failure, craving loyalty but distrusting everyone. Some stories explore his past, like his origins in 'Transformers: Prime', where his vulnerability contrasts sharply with his usual arrogance. Others reimagine him as a reluctant leader, forced to confront his own flaws when power finally lands in his hands. The best fics don’t just make him a schemer; they humanize him, showing the loneliness beneath the treachery.

What fascinates me is how writers use his relationship with Megatron to mirror toxic dynamics—abuse, manipulation, and twisted dependency. In 'Tarnished Wings', a popular AU, Starscream’s defiance is framed as self-destructive rebellion, while in 'Ghosts of Cybertron', he grapples with guilt from betraying his own ideals. The fandom loves to pit his cunning against his emotional fragility, creating scenarios where he almost wins… only to self-sabotage. Some even pair him with unlikely allies, like Soundwave or Optimus Prime, to explore redemption arcs. His character thrives in fanworks because he’s a mess of contradictions—grandiose yet pitiable, vicious yet oddly sympathetic.

How is Starscream's rivalry with Megatron reimagined in fanfiction with emotional depth?

2 Answers2026-02-26 20:17:46
Starscream and Megatron's rivalry in fanfiction often gets twisted into something way more personal than the explosive power struggles we see in 'Transformers'. I've read fics where Starscream isn't just a traitorous lieutenant but a deeply wounded character, scarred by Megatron's emotional abuse and manipulation. Some writers frame their dynamic as a toxic romance, blending obsession with violence—Megatron keeps pulling him back, and Starscream keeps betraying him, but there's this twisted dependency. The best fics dig into Starscream's inferiority complex, how he craves recognition but self-sabotages, while Megatron alternates between crushing him and needing his brilliance. One memorable AU even reimagined them as fallen lovers from Cybertron's golden age, with Megatron as a revolutionary leader who promised equality but became a tyrant, and Starscream as the idealist who couldn't escape his shadow. The emotional weight comes from Starscream's futile hope—he still believes, somewhere, that the Megatron he once admired exists. Other fics flip the script, making Starscream the tragic hero. There's this heartbreaking trend where he's portrayed as a survivor of war trauma, his defiance a mask for PTSD. Megatron's cruelty isn't just about dominance; it's calculated to break him psychologically. I stumbled on a fic where Starscream's infamous backstabbing was a desperate bid for autonomy, and Megatron's punishments were framed like an abusive partner's gaslighting. The comments section was full of readers sobbing over how real it felt. What gets me is how fanfiction transforms their rivalry from cartoonish villainy into a metaphor for cycles of abuse, with Starscream's wings (often emphasized as sensitive or damaged) symbolizing his crushed freedom. The best writers make you forget they're giant robots—it's just raw, human pain.
